The Role

This isn’t a sit in the office kind of role. As our Food & Beverage Manager, you’ll be the driving force behind the entire F&B operation—restaurant, bars, room service, and events. You’ll be out on the floor, setting the tone, raising standards, and making sure every guest experience feels effortless and exceptional.

You will:

  • Lead from the front—visible, hands-on, and inspiring your team every shift
  • Create a culture where great service is instinctive, not scripted
  • Own performance—from guest satisfaction to budgets and cost control
  • Develop your team through coaching, training, and daily briefings
  • Keep standards sharp—from presentation to compliance and hygiene
  • Play a key role in shaping the future of our dining experience

How to prepare for a job interview at Comis Hotel Golf Resort

✨Know the Venue Inside Out

Before your interview, take some time to research Comis Hotel & Golf Resort. Familiarise yourself with their dining options, events, and overall vibe. This will not only show your genuine interest but also help you tailor your answers to align with their vision of creating memorable experiences.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Style

As a Food and Beverage Manager, leading from the front is crucial. Be prepared to discuss your leadership style and provide examples of how you've inspired teams in the past. Highlight specific situations where your hands-on approach made a difference in guest satisfaction or team performance.

✨Demonstrate Your Commercial Savvy

Since managing budgets and cost control is key for this role, come ready to discuss your experience with financial management in F&B settings. Share examples of how you've successfully balanced quality service with budget constraints, and be ready to suggest ideas for improving profitability at Comis.
